The acidity and alkalinity of a substance are measured using a scale of numbers which ranges from 0 to 14 called the pH scale. It measures the concentration of hydrogen ions in a solution. Remember, the Arrhenius definition of an acid that says that an acid is a compound which when dissolved in water produces hydrogen ion as the only positive ion while according to Bronsted-lowry, an acid is a proton donor and a base is a proton acceptor. Recall that a proton is a hydrogen ion.

HYDROGEN ION CONCENTRATION
To understand this, we have to critically look at the dissociation of water. Pure water is a neutral solution. It ionizes very slightly to give equal concentrations of hydrogen ions and hydroxide ions. This is confirmed by conductivity measurements which shows that at 25oC, the concentration of hydrogen ions [H+] and the concentration of the hydroxide ions [OH–] are both equal to 10-7 moldm-3 respectively.

THE IONIC PRODUCT OF WATER KW
The ionic product of water is the product of the concentration of H+ and OH–
KW = [H+] [OH–]
=10-7moldm-3 x 10-7moldm-3
=10-14mol2dm-6.
The ionic product of water, KW is kept constant under all circumstances at 25oC. This means that in all neutral solutions, the concentration of both hydrogen ions and hydroxide ions would be 10-7moldm-3 respectively. If an acid is added to an aqueous solution, the hydrogen ion concentration increases to above 10-7 moldm-3. In order to maintain the ionic product of water, KW at 10-14 mol2dm-6, the hydroxide ions would decrease proportionally. For instance, if concentration of the [H+] increases from 10-7 moldm-3 to 10-4moldm-3, the concentration of [OH–] will decrease from 10-7moldm-3 to 10-10moldm-3. The solution becomes more acidic since the concentration of H+ ions is more than the concentration of OH– ions. A solution becomes more alkaline if the concentration of hydroxide ions is more than the concentration of hydrogen ions.
pH SCALE
pH scale ranges from 0 to 14 . As the value of pH decreases, the acidity of the solution increases and as the value of pH increases, the acidity decreases while the alkalinity increases. The pH of a neutral solution is 7.
This means that a value of less than 7 on the scale is acidic while a value greater than 7 on the scale is alkaline.
